Question : In a division sum, the divisor is 13 times the quotient and 6 times the remainder. If the remainder is 39, the dividend is:
Option 1: 4240
Option 2: 4576
Option 3: 4251
Option 4: 4800
Correct Answer: 4251
Solution : Divisor = 13 × Quotient Divisor = 6 × Remainder Remainder = 39 ⇒ Divisor = 39 × 6 = 234 So, Quotient $=\frac{234}{13} = 18$ Dividend = Divisor $×$ Quotient + Remainder $\therefore$ Dividend = 234 × 18 + 39 = 4251 Hence, the
Question : If 10% of $x$ is 3 times of 15% of $y$, then find $x:y$.
Option 1: $7:2$
Option 2: $9:2$
Option 3: $8:3$
Option 4: $11:4$
Correct Answer: $9:2$
Solution : Given: $10$% of $x$ = $3×15$% of $y$ ⇒ $x×\frac{10}{100}=3×y×\frac{15}{100}$ ⇒ $10x=45y$ ⇒ $\frac{x}{y}=\frac{45}{10}=\frac{9}{2}$ ⇒ $x:y=9:2$ Hence, the correct answer is $9:2$.

Question : S sells an item costing Rs. 37800 to P with 8% profit. P sells it to Q with a 4% loss. At what price (in Rs.) does P sell the item? (Correct to the nearest rupee)
Option 1: 39919
Option 2: 39119
Option 3: 39191
Option 4: 39911
Correct Answer: 39191
Solution : S sells an item costing Rs. 37800 to P with 8% profit. Buying price for P $=\frac{100+8}{100}×37800=\frac{108}{100}×37800=40824$ Now, P sells the item to Q with a 4% loss. $\therefore$ Selling price for P $=\frac{100-4}{100}×40824=\frac{96}{100}×40824=39191.04\approx39191$ Hence, the correct answer is 39191.
